宝塔安装失败可能是由于多种原因导致的,比如网络问题、环境不满足要求、权限不足等。本文将详细分析宝塔安装失败的原因,并提供相应的解决办法,以帮助用户顺利完成宝塔的安装。
一、宝塔安装失败的原因
1. 网络问题
在安装宝塔过程中,如果网络不稳定或者无法连接到宝塔官方服务器,可能会导致安装失败。此时,用户需要检查网络连接是否正常,并确保能够访问宝塔官方服务器。
2. 环境不满足要求
宝塔安装对操作系统、版本、依赖库等有一定的要求。如果环境不满足要求,可能会导致安装失败。以下是宝塔对环境的要求:
(1)操作系统:CentOS 5.x/6.x/7.x、Debian 7.x/8.x、Ubuntu 14.04/16.04/18.04/20.04等。
(2)版本:32位或64位操作系统。
(3)依赖库:openssl、gcc、make、openssl-devel、pcre、pcre-devel、zlib、zlib-devel、libxml2、libxml2-devel、libxslt、libxslt-devel、libpng、libpng-devel、libjpeg、libjpeg-devel等。
3. 权限不足
在安装宝塔过程中,需要以root用户身份进行。如果用户权限不足,可能会导致安装失败。此时,用户需要确保拥有root权限。
4. 服务器配置问题
服务器配置不当,如内核参数设置不正确、防火墙设置等,也可能导致宝塔安装失败。
二、宝塔安装失败的解决办法
1. 检查网络连接
如果怀疑是网络问题导致安装失败,可以尝试以下方法:
(1)检查网络连接是否正常。
(2)确保能够访问宝塔官方服务器(http://www.bt.cn/)。
(3)如果网络连接正常,可以尝试更换网络环境,如使用手机热点等。
2. 检查环境要求
(1)确认操作系统版本是否满足要求。
(2)检查依赖库是否安装齐全。
(3)如果依赖库未安装,可以使用以下命令进行安装:
```bash
# CentOS
yum install -y openssl gcc make openssl-devel pcre pcre-devel zlib zlib-devel libxml2 libxml2-devel libxslt libxslt-devel libpng libpng-devel libjpeg libjpeg-devel
# Debian/Ubuntu
apt-get update
apt-get install -y openssl gcc make libssl-dev libpcre3 libpcre3-dev zlib1g zlib1g-dev libxml2 libxml2-dev libxslt1.1 libxslt1.1-dev libpng-dev libjpeg-dev
```
3. 确保拥有root权限
(1)使用root用户登录服务器。
(2)如果当前用户不是root用户,可以使用以下命令切换到root用户:
```bash
sudo su
```
4. 优化服务器配置
(1)检查内核参数设置,确保符合要求。
(2)关闭防火墙,或添加宝塔端口到防火墙白名单。
```bash
# 关闭防火墙
systemctl stop firewalld
systemctl disable firewalld
# 添加端口到防火墙白名单
iptables -A INPUT -p tcp --dport 80 -j ACCEPT
iptables -A INPUT -p tcp --dport 443 -j ACCEPT
iptables -A INPUT -p tcp --dport 21 -j ACCEPT
iptables -A INPUT -p tcp --dport 22 -j ACCEPT
iptables -A INPUT -p tcp --dport 3306 -j ACCEPT
iptables -A INPUT -p tcp --dport 8080 -j ACCEPT
iptables -A INPUT -p tcp --dport 2082 -j ACCEPT
iptables -A INPUT -p tcp --dport 10000 -j ACCEPT
```
(3)优化服务器性能,如调整文件描述符限制等。
三、宝塔安装失败的衍升问题及解答
1. 问:宝塔安装失败后,如何恢复数据?
答:在安装宝塔之前,请确保备份数据。如果安装失败,可以根据备份恢复数据。
2. 问:宝塔安装失败后,如何查看错误日志?
答:宝塔安装失败后,可以在宝塔安装目录下的`logs`文件夹中找到错误日志文件,如`install.log`。
3. 问:宝塔安装失败后,如何卸载宝塔?
答:使用以下命令卸载宝塔:
```bash
# 进入宝塔安装目录
cd /www/server
# 卸载宝塔
./uninstall.sh
```
4. 问:宝塔安装失败后,如何重新安装宝塔?
答:在解决导致安装失败的问题后,可以使用以下命令重新安装宝塔:
```bash
# 进入宝塔安装目录
cd /www/server
# 重新安装宝塔
./install.sh
```
通过以上分析和解答,相信用户能够更好地解决宝塔安装失败的问题。在安装过程中,请务必注意检查网络、环境、权限等因素,以确保顺利完成宝塔的安装。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态